Summary

Lab Technicians perform a variety of routine, technical, and administrative responsibilities in support of research at the university. They perform duties such as the following: collecting specimens, preparing materials, operating and maintaining equipment, ordering lab supplies, and maintaining inventory. They also assist with data analysis and report writing. They may work independently or as a member of a team. They work under general supervision, resolving most standard issues independently and referring complex issues to an upper-level manager. Technicians typically report to a manager or director or may report to a department administrator.

Typical Duties

Research, Analysis & Reporting

  • Reviews and revises standard operating procedures.

  • Provides technical support to medical residents, fellows, and other personnel.

  • Implements, manages, and provides services for analytical processing of samples obtained by micro-dissection including but not limited to extraction of nerve and muscle tissues.

  • Carries out basic and clinical research protocols as described and designed by the laboratory director. These include microsurgery on rats, histological analysis, statistical analysis, neurophysiologic testing. Assists in the design of experiments and interprets results.

  • Performs statistical analysis of data using the statistical software such as SPSS, sigma stat, etc.

  • Prepares reports, both verbal and written regarding laboratory results.

  • Maintains mouse/rate colonies and performs experiments in vivo.

  • Performs surgical manipulation of laboratory animals, care and monitoring of animals, euthanasia of animals, data collection, record keeping, and any other tasks associated with the scientific study. Participates in the assessment and collection of clinical research as related to hand, wrist, and extremity reconstructive microsurgery. Communicates with study patients and participants to interview and collect data. Assists microsurgery director in management of specimen handling that provides nerve and muscle samples to principal investigators and sub/co investigators. Supervises maintenance of instruments and validation of new instrumentation.

  • Independently troubleshoots instrument, assay, and or/analytical problems to prevent delays in testing. Initiates repairs as needed.

  • Communicates with study patients and participants to interview and collect data.

  • Performs basic science bench research.

Resident Research Coordinating & Training

  • Supports the educational program for training residents and medical students in the methods of microsurgical and electrophysiological testing.

  • Support may include contributing to the quality and content of the basic techniques and instructional information of the educational program.

  • Trains students, residents, and new employee's basic science procedures and protocols and in lab safety.

  • Oversees resident involvement in microsurgical research projects and microsurgical training exercises.

  • Performs group or individual microsurgery instruction to students, residents, and fellows in the Orthopaedic Surgery.

  • Offers microsurgery training to residents and partners in other departments who require these skills to strengthen their clinical work. Tests resident/fellows for readiness to participate by evaluating aptitude to do work with animals.

  • Confirm health status of resident/fellows. Attends all IACUC and other regulatory authorities' mandated meetings and seminars.

  • Assures completion of competency assessments in a timely manner and maintains records of same.

  • Keeps up to date with all safety and regulatory requirements.

Lab Safety & Compliance Coordination

  • Functions as the laboratory safety officer.

  • Responsible for compliance with all regulatory requirements, and the safe use of hazardous materials in the laboratory, including biological and chemical agents, required by IACUC (Institutional Animal Care and Use Committee).

  • Demonstrates knowledge of all local, state, and federal laws and regulations regarding laboratory testing.

  • Is familiar with all emergency response procedures (RACER).

  • Participates in all VCUHS and Department of Orthopaedic Surgery essential education and safety training and provides appropriate documentation to laboratory director.

  • Complies with Department of Orthopedic Surgery dress code and PPE (personal protective equipment) policies.

  • Complies with all safety requirements for safe handling of specimens in designated areas.

  • Reports all laboratory accidents to director immediately.

  • Supervises quality control of specimen and data analysis.

  • Identifies quality control trends and shifts. Investigates and resolve problems.

  • Ensures corrective actions are appropriate and documented according to SOPs. Ensures compliance to protocols and test validation procedures which may comprise all or part of a basic science research protocol with appropriate regulatory guidelines.
